S2-8
8-position DIP switch, position 8
Sets P1_MODE3 low when closed (on).
Otherwise, the signal is pulled-up internally.
This switch selects the duplex polarity strap
default for Port 1 as follows:
If the strap value is “0”, a “0” on P1_DUPLEX
indicates full duplex, while a “1” indicates
half-duplex.
If the strap value is “1”, a “1” on P1_DUPLEX
indicates full duplex, while a “0” indicates
half-duplex.
The default setting is open.
